Diagnosing Common HVAC Line Set Issues
When your heating system isn't performing as expected, inspecting the line set is a crucial first step. These refrigerant lines can develop issues that hamper efficiency and effectiveness.
Common culprits include frozen coils, leaks, and damaged connections. A qualified HVAC technician can pinpoint these issues and offer the necessary fixes.
Here are some common line set issues to be aware of:
* Punctures: These can occur throughout the line set, causing refrigerant loss and reducing system efficiency.
* Frozen Coils: This problem happens when airflow is restricted, leading to a buildup of frost on the coils. It interferes heat transfer and reduces system performance.
* Wear: Over time, line sets can become corroded due to exposure to the elements or agents. This can lead to vulnerability and potential leaks.
Scheduled maintenance by a licensed HVAC technician can help minimize these issues and keep your cooling system running smoothly.
Benefits of Using a Pre-Charged Line Set
Installing a pre-charged line set can be a real time saver for HVAC technicians. These line sets are already loaded with refrigerant, eliminating the need to remove air and then charge the system after installation. This means you can spend less time on setup and more time performing other tasks.
Another plus is that pre-charged line sets minimize the risk of refrigerant leaks during setup. With proper handling, these line sets are designed to be leak-proof, ensuring a more effective cooling or heating system.
